In this article Jay investigates the environmental impact of mass music events on the Environment. Data was mostly collected through an interview with Mr Lionel Gerada, Artistic Director of Malta Tourism Authority, responsible for the organisation of mass music events in Malta. This article shows the complexity of keeping a balance between attracting tourists to Malta and trying to respect our environment. It also takes a glimpse at how international mass music events organisers are trying to tackle this issue.

In this article Ella investigates the environmental impact of streaming. Streaming is the most popular way of listening to music today. But few people are aware of the environmental impact of this new way of listening to music. It is easy to see how the use of casettes, vinyls and CDs impact the environment but with streaming the link is more difficult to see. Ella Rose Clarke – Effects of Streaming, https://rb.gy/36d4t

The EkoSkola committee through the Litter Less Campaign, YRE and LEAF started to emphasize the need to separate waste in our school. All classes have been given an organic bin, a recyclable waste bin, and a general waste bin. Students are being encouraged to separate waste in these bins. Furthermore, different flashcards and visuals were given out to all classes to continue to strengthen the need to separate waste correctly. With this project, our school is giving the opportunity and knowledge to the students and continuing in helping the environment around us.
